Considering the urban rail transit passenger composition, a calculation model of carbon emissions based on transfer wishes was constructed by analyzing the mechanism of environmental benefit from the positive and negative parts. Then based on the shadow price formula, the shadow price of the carbon emissions calculation method suitable for rail transport was proposed when carbon emissions would be a scarce resource in the future. Finally, these two models were combined into a quantitate model of the environmental values in urban rail transit based on the carbon emissions. To verify the feasibility of the model, the monetary value of the environmental benefits of the Nanning Rail Transit Line 2 in one year was calculated. This forward-looking model can contribute to the low-carbon process, providing references about the urban rail transit subsidy amount and manner for the government.
